There are really two points that I think need to be highlighted before anyone goes on this tour: 1. At 25 euros it was quite pricey 2. It was a funny tour rather than a creepy ghost tour Having said that I really enjoyed it. It wasn't what I had expected, I had expected a couple of hours of thrills and chills and horrific ghost stories, whereas in reality it was a couple of hours of comedy delivered by very funny costumed actors. It was very different to your average ghost tour, but what I had been looking for was something of a slightly scarier nature.
